27 lines
398 B
Groovy
27 lines
398 B
Groovy
|
|
project.install {
|
|
repositories.mavenInstaller {
|
|
configurePom(project, pom)
|
|
}
|
|
}
|
|
project.uploadArchives {
|
|
repositories.mavenDeployer {
|
|
configurePom(project, pom)
|
|
}
|
|
}
|
|
|
|
def configurePom(project, pom) {
|
|
|
|
pom.whenConfigured { generatedPom ->
|
|
generatedPom.project {
|
|
developers {
|
|
developer {
|
|
id = 'jxblum'
|
|
name = "John Blum"
|
|
email = "jblum@pivotal.io"
|
|
}
|
|
}
|
|
}
|
|
}
|
|
}
|